Table 1. Average Annual Salary

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$43,250
25th Percentile Wage
$52,750
50th Percentile Wage
$68,550
75th Percentile Wage
$92,300
90th Percentile Wage
$115,380

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for compensation, benefits, and job analysis specialists in the industry of other nondepository credit intermediation.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) compensation, benefits, and job analysis specialists is $115,380.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$68,550.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ent compensation, benefits, and job analysis specialists is $43,250.
